Transaction 143b45f516312839f2f664400875ebde4ef0c5e8a74c7a17122dc0a70a33e77e

1 Input
2 Outputs
  • 143b45f516312839f2f664400875ebde4ef0c5e8a74c7a17122dc0a70a33e77e:0
  • value  136322
    address  bc1qjhnkxnrmgks8n596958kvlr4j4zx344he02ppw
  • 143b45f516312839f2f664400875ebde4ef0c5e8a74c7a17122dc0a70a33e77e:1
  • value  7403559
    address  39taQSBd8jM2G5DGRewpdC2QJ1UZPckdTj